Today’s interview is with Zig Serafin, CEO at Qualtrics, the leading Experience Management software provider. I spoke to Zig at Qualtrics’ recent X4 event in Salt Lake City. We talked about Qualtrics’ vision, the highlights from the event, the XM Operating system, Qualtrics AI and the hundred different AI models that they have built, how they are empowering 43 out of 50 of the world’s largest brands to listen and then take action at scale and in real-time and the upcoming Qualtrics X4 EMEA event in London on June 6th.
